GREAT WALL OF SINDH
“The Great Wall of Sindh also known as Dewar-e-Sindh in Sindhi and Urdu is the world’s largest fort with a circumference of about 26 km or 16 miles. Since 1993, it has been on the list of tentative UNESCO World Heritage Sites”
